Guacamole
Guacamole is one of the easiest things in the world to make. In reality, it’s just smashed avocados, blended with coriander, some lime juice and salt. It makes for a versatile side or condiment, and can be served as a dip, or spread over breads.
The key thing is storage and consumption. Once prepared, guacamole is best consumed when fresh, and while it will keep in the refrigerator, it will oxidise and turn brown very quickly.
